  • Highlights of the first 100+ lb Yellowfin Tuna (Ahi) caught from a kayak on Kauai. Caught on a 7 ft Shimano Tallus rod and Shimano Talica 16 II reel. Additional footage provided by Kyle Yokoyama. Shot entirely with Gopro action cameras. Mahalo to AFTCO, Hawaiian Ola, K2 Coolers, and KNEKTUSA for the support.
